      PM Netanyahu speaks with UN Secy-Gen Ban Ki-Moon

      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, on Friday afternoon, 10 August 2012, spoke with UN Secretary-General Ban Ki-Moon and told him that his anticipated trip to Tehran this month is a major mistake even if it is being made with good intentions.

      The 18th Anniversary of the AMIA bombing

      Eighteen years ago today, in the morning hours of 18 July 1994, a murderous attack was carried out against the Jewish community center AMIA (Asociación Mutual Israelita Argentina) in Buenos Aires.
